Johanne Eleonore was born in 1833. She passed away in 1916.
3 Apr 1833, Klastawe, Posen, Prussia
Arrived barque Catharina, 350 tons, Captain Peter Schacht, Hamburg 21st September 1838, arrived at Port Adelaide, South Australia 22nd January 1839
